Blue Exorcist
Ever wished you could just casually become an exorcist? Blue Exorcist is your jam! Rin Okumura discovers he's the son of Satan and, in a twist, decides to train to become an exorcist. Prepare for lots of action, demon-slaying, and that classic "hidden identity" trope we all secretly love.

Fruits Basket
Okay, hear me out! It doesn't have devils, BUT it has the zodiac spirits, and they're just as complicated. Fruits Basket follows Tohru Honda, who discovers the Sohma family's secret: they transform into zodiac animals when hugged by someone of the opposite sex. Expect awkward situations, heartwarming moments, and more than a few love triangles.

Noragami
Yato is a minor god with dreams of a glorious shrine and millions of worshippers. Hiyori Iki, after saving Yato from a bus accident, finds herself able to slip out of her body. Noragami is about their unlikely partnership as they navigate the spirit world, battling phantoms and trying to earn Yato some recognition.
The Ancient Magus' Bride
Chise Hatori, feeling utterly alone, sells herself at auction and is bought by Elias Ainsworth, a mage with the head of a beast. The Ancient Magus' Bride is a slow-burn fantasy with breathtaking artwork and a deep exploration of loneliness, belonging, and the meaning of family. Their connection is strange, powerful, and undeniably captivating.
